Figure shows two large cylindrical shells having uniform linera charge densities `+ lambda` and `- lambda`. Radius of inner cylinder is 'a' and that of outer cylinder is 'b'. A charged particle of mass m, charge q revolves in a circle of radius r. Then, its speed 'v' is : (Neglect gravity and assume the radii of both the cylinders to be very small in comparison to their length.)

A

`sqrt((lambdaq)/(2pi in_(0)m))`

B

`sqrt((2lambdaq)/(pi in_(0)m))`

C

`sqrt((lambdaq)/(pi in_(0)m))`

D

`sqrt((lambdaq)/(4pi in_(0)m))`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
A
